Roberto Morales-Rivera, of 160 St. Stephens Road, smashed the window of a 2008 Mitsubishi Endeavor in the parking lot of Planet Fitness in Fairfield, police said. He found the keys to the car in a pocketbook, which was inside the car, police said.
Police said Morales-Rivera then drove out of the parking lot in the car, but the car's owners followed him to the P.T. Barnum housing complex in Bridgeport and called police.
Morales-Rivera was apprehended after running from officers, police said. He was arrested and charged with third-degree larceny and second-degree criminal trover, police said.
He was held on $10,000 bond. His court date is July 15, police said.
